Understanding Raloxifene HCl Dosage for Effective Treatment

Raloxifene HCl is a medication primarily used to prevent and treat osteoporosis in postmenopausal women, as well as to reduce the risk of invasive breast cancer. Understanding the correct dosage is crucial for achieving optimal results while minimizing potential side effects.

Recommended Dosage

The standard dosage for Raloxifene HCl usually follows these guidelines:

  1. Osteoporosis Treatment and Prevention: Typically, the recommended dose is 60 mg taken once daily.
  2. Breast Cancer Risk Reduction: The dosage remains the same at 60 mg daily.
  3. Administration: Raloxifene can be taken with or without food.

Factors Influencing Dosage

Several factors may influence the appropriate dosage, including:

  • Age and weight of the patient
  • Overall health and medical history
  • Other medications being taken

Potential Side Effects

While Raloxifene HCl is generally well tolerated, some patients may experience side effects such as:

  • Hot flashes
  • Leg cramps
  • Swelling or redness in the legs

Consult Your Healthcare Provider

It is essential to consult a healthcare provider before starting Raloxifene HCl to ensure that the medication is appropriate for your specific circumstances and to determine the best dosage for your needs.
